Yeocheon NCC raises naphtha cracker utilisation to 65 percent
Yeocheon NCC has raised the operating rate of its naphtha cracking plant to 65 percent from 60 percent, the company said on Sunday. It cited improved conditions for stabilising supply and demand, after the government introduced a subsidy policy to support naphtha purchases and a financial support system was also put in place. The company’s utilisation fell to 55 percent last month amid higher feedstock prices and supply uncertainty linked to a prolonged Middle East situation.

HD Hyundai, Lotte Daesan integration approved, government to provide 2.1 trillion won support
South Korea has approved the petrochemical industry’s first business restructuring project and will move to provide support worth 2.1 trillion won, the Ministry of Trade, Industry and Energy said. The plan integrates Lotte Chemical’s Daesan operations with HD Hyundai Chemical, with shareholders to inject 1.2 trillion won into a new entity. It includes shutting down 1.1 million tonnes of NCC capacity and some overlapping downstream facilities over a 3-year restructuring period.

Namutech wins security function verification for NCC-VDI virtual desktop solution
Namutech said on Monday its cloud-based virtual desktop solution, NCC-VDI (DaaS) 5.1, has obtained a security function verification certificate from the IT Security Certification Secretariat. The company said the certification recognises a centralised security operations model in a multi-hypervisor DaaS environment combining Nutanix and Citrix technologies. It said the certification meets public procurement requirements for entry into high-security sectors including public, financial and defence.
